Sunline fan....interesting point. Never thought that the '03's would be considered more "beat up" in a 7.3 over a brand new 6.0. My thinking is that most "Powerstroke Fans" would be all over the immediate acceleration and turbo sound of the 6.0 and since this was before the "issues" started it would have been the engine of choice...at least until the dealer / shop visits started adding up.

I wonder how long Ford produced the 7.3 in the 2003 model year? Seems very few examples could be found?

I think a lot of people did wait for a 6.0, as most of them out there are. But after the problems were known, I think people got those early '03s ASAP either as leftovers or slightly used. I'm sure some who got them did because they already had other 7.3s in their fleet and wanted to keep maintenance the same. I don't know any of this for sure, but I'm just speculating. When I was searching insurance wrecks a lot, I tried to find an '03. Every one that I found usually had over 200k on it and just looked beat. I found the '02 I have and it was the lowest mileage 7.3 on there at the time, and if I ever found a lower one, it was usually around only 130k.

IIRC, the 7.3s were put in '03 Excursions up through sometime in mid November 2002. The model year starts in late July/early August.

The easiest way to tell an '03 7.3 is by the VIN. The eighth digit is the engine code. L for the 5.4 gas, S for the 6.8 V10 gas, F for the 7.3, and P for the 6.0.
